More than that, the power of words can even change a person's mindset and encourage him to do something according to the words. History has proven how powerful the power of a word is. Bung Karno for example, the first president of the Republic of Indonesia whose figure was also known as a great orator, through the power of the words he delivered, he was able to inflame the spirit of the homeland fighters to win independence from the hands of the invaders.
In the history of Islamic civilization, there was a former slave named Tariq bin Ziyad who became the great leader of the conqueror of Europe. He is also known as a person whose power of words can ignite enthusiasm. His famous speech was when he ordered his troops to burn their own ships, "There is no way to escape. The sea behind you, while the enemy is right in front of you. For God's sake, there is nothing you can do now except to be sincerely full of sincerity and patience.

Inspirational Words of Wisdom from the Qur'an
The Qur'an as a holy book is certainly the most complete source of motivation and inspiration. Here are some Islamic wise words taken from pieces of the Qur'anic verses, full of advice and inspiration that will bring our lives in a more positive direction.
وَهُوَ مَعَكُمْ أَيْنَ مَا كُنْتُمْ
And He is with you wherever you are. – (QS. Al-Hadid: 4)
وَلَا تَسْتَوِي الْحَسَنَةُ وَلَا السَّيِّئَةُ ۚادْفَعْ بِالَّتِي هِيَ أَحْسَنُ فَإِذَا الَّذِي بَيْنَكَ وَبَيْنَهُ عَدَاوَةٌ كَأَنَّهُ وَلِيٌّ حَمِيمٌ
Good and evil deeds are not equal. Repel evil with what is better; then you will see that one who was once your enemy has become your dearest friend. – (QS. Fusshilat: 34)
إِنَّ اللَّهَ لَا يُغَيِّرُ مَا بِقَوْمٍ حَتَّىٰ يُغَيِّرُوا مَا بِأَنْفُسِهِمْ
Allah never changes the condition of a people unless they strive to change Themselves. – (QS. Ar-Ra’d: 11)
لَا يُكَلِّفُ اللَّهُ نَفْسًا إِلَّا وُسْعَهَا
Allah does not burden a soul beyond that it can bear. – (QS. Al-Baqarah: 286)
فَإِنَّ مَعَ الْعُسْرِ يُسْرًا
So, Verily, With Every Difficulty, There is Relief. – (QS. Al-Insyirah: 5)
يُؤْتِكُمْ خَيْرًا مِمَّا أُخِذَ مِنْكُمْ
He will give you something better than what has been taken from you. – (QS. Al-Anfal: 70)
إِنَّا لِلَّهِ وَإِنَّا إِلَيْهِ رَاجِعُونَ
Indeed we belong to Allah, and indeed to Him we will return. – (QS. Al-Baqarah: 156)
لَئِنْ شَكَرْتُمْ لَأَزِيدَنَّكُمْ
If you are grateful, I will give you more. – (QS. Ibrahim: 7)
وَرَحْمَتِي وَسِعَتْ كُلَّ شَيْءٍ
My Mercy embraces all things. – (QS. Al-A’raf: 156)
فَلَا تَغُرَّنَّكُمُ الْحَيَاةُ الدُّنْيَا
So let not this present life deceive you. – (QS. Fathir: 5)
